Melt-blown materials are extruded by heating and melting, and then ejected by hot air through the pores of the nozzle. Under the traction and stretching of the hot air, micron or even sub-micron level fibers are formed. The accumulation of fibers can be To form a filter membrane, the melt-blown filter membrane generally used for flat masks is 25g of melt-blown material. Before melt-blown materials undergo electrostatic electret treatment, the filtration efficiency of melt-blown materials is relatively low, about 30%-40% of the aerosol filtration performance.
PTFE nano mask cloth is mainly due to its use of materials with smaller fiber diameters compared with traditional masks. Generally speaking, the fiber diameter of the ordinary non-woven materials used in our traditional masks is more than 1000 nanometers, while the fiber diameter of the PTFE membrane is between 100 and 200 nanometers, which is much smaller than the above diameter, so it can It is very effective in blocking PM2.5 in the air, as well as some viruses, bacteria and particles that are invisible to the naked eye.
